The low calorie snacks market is experiencing rapid growth as consumers increasingly prioritize health and wellness. Changing lifestyles and growing awareness about nutrition are encouraging people to choose healthier snack options. The demand for healthy low calorie snack options is significantly driving the market forward.

One of the primary factors influencing this growth is the rising prevalence of obesity and lifestyle-related diseases. Consumers are becoming more conscious of their calorie intake and are actively seeking snacks that support weight management without compromising taste.

The shift toward healthier eating habits is also being driven by increased access to nutritional information. Labels, online resources, and health campaigns are helping consumers make informed decisions about their food choices.

Product innovation is another key factor contributing to market growth. Manufacturers are developing snacks that are not only low in calories but also rich in nutrients. These include baked chips, protein bars, and fruit-based snacks.

The influence of fitness trends and social media is also significant. Health influencers and fitness enthusiasts are promoting low-calorie diets, encouraging more consumers to adopt healthier snacking habits.

Additionally, the availability of these products across supermarkets, convenience stores, and online platforms is making them more accessible to consumers.
